散瞳是医学术语,指瞳孔扩张,即瞳孔变得异常大。

这种症状可能是在低光源环境下自然发生的(以便让更多光线进入眼睛),也可能是医学原因引起的。瞳孔扩张通常在眼科检查中被有意使用,以便更清晰地观察视网膜、视神经和眼内其他结构。它在诊断各种眼科疾病至关重要,包括青光眼、糖尿病视网膜病变和老龄化黄斑部病变(AMD)。

散瞳症可以透过使用托吡卡胺、苯肾上腺素或阿托品等散瞳药物来诱发,这些药物可以放鬆瞳孔周围的肌肉,使瞳孔扩张。虽然散瞳症通常是一种暂时性疾病,但神经系统疾病、眼外伤以及某些药物的作用也可能引起散瞳症。

儘管散瞳剂市场正在成长,但仍有许多挑战阻碍其发展。其中最主要的挑战之一是散瞳剂的副作用和安全隐患。虽然这些药物可以有效地扩张瞳孔用于诊断,但它们可能导致眼部不适、眼压升高、畏光(对光敏感)和视力模糊。在某些情况下,它们还可能引起全身副作用,例如心率加快和高血压,尤其对于患有高血压或心血管疾病等潜在疾病的人。

此外,过度扩张的风险可能会使诊断过程复杂化,或在后续治疗中引起副作用。有些患者,尤其是老年人、糖尿病患者或青光眼患者,扩张过程可能有困难,可能需要额外的监测或调整。

此类安全隐患可能会限制散瞳剂的广泛使用,尤其是在脆弱的患者群体中,并减缓某些散瞳疗法的普及。这项挑战凸显了对更安全、更有效的替代方案的需求,这些方案既能达到诊断操作所需的瞳孔扩大程度,又能最大限度地减少副作用。

Mydriasis is a medical term that refers to the dilation of the pupil, where the pupil becomes abnormally enlarged. This condition can occur naturally in response to low light conditions (to allow more light into the eye) or can be induced for medical reasons. Mydriasis is often used intentionally in ophthalmology during eye exams to provide a clearer view of the retina, optic nerve, and other structures inside the eye. It is essential for the diagnosis of various eye conditions, including glaucoma, diabetic retinopathy, and age-related macular degeneration (AMD).

Mydriasis can be induced using mydriatic agents, such as tropicamide, phenylephrine, or atropine, which relax the muscles around the pupil, causing it to dilate. While it is typically a temporary condition, mydriasis can also occur due to neurological disorders, eye trauma, or the effects of certain medications.

Despite the growth of the Mydriasis market, several challenges continue to hinder its progress. One of the primary challenges is the side effects and safety concerns associated with mydriatic agents. While these agents are effective in inducing pupil dilation for diagnostic purposes, they can cause ocular discomfort, increased intraocular pressure, photophobia (sensitivity to light), and blurred vision. In some cases, they may also cause systemic side effects, such as increased heart rate or high blood pressure, particularly in individuals with underlying health conditions like hypertension or cardiovascular diseases.

Additionally, there is a risk of over-dilation, which can complicate the diagnostic process or lead to adverse effects during subsequent treatment. Some patients, especially the elderly or those with diabetes or glaucoma, may experience difficulty with the dilation process, potentially requiring additional monitoring or adjustments.

These safety concerns limit the widespread use of mydriatic agents, especially in vulnerable patient populations, and may slow the adoption of certain types of mydriatic treatments. This challenge underscores the need for safer, more effective alternatives that can minimize side effects while still achieving the necessary level of pupil dilation for diagnostic procedures.
